Subject: Crashline cut-over complete

The mobile crash-report pipeline now runs entirely on the Bramwick ingest cluster; the legacy collector was drained and decommissioned this morning. Symbolication latency is back under two minutes and no reports were dropped during the switch. For future reference, the pipeline was brought up with the following configuration.

service settings:
PRAWYN_PIN=9848
PRAWYN_METRICS_HOST=metrics.prawyn.lumicworks.corp
PRAWYN_LOG_LEVEL=warn
PRAWYN_TENANT=pelius

Subject: Quickstore 4.2 — bloom filter now fronts the KV layer

Plugin authors: starting with this release, Quickstore places a bloom filter ahead of the key-value store. Negative lookups return faster; false positives fall through safely. No API changes are required on your side. Verify your plugin against the staging build referenced below.

session token of fahif-tadup = htk3_9c7

Subject: Handover — font vendoring, Glyphbarn 4.2

Torin,

Taking over releases from me this cycle. Context for your review: we now vendor the Quillmont and Sable Sans families directly into the Glyphbarn build instead of pulling from the upstream mirror. Licenses checked, hashes pinned in the manifest. Build reproducibility verified on two runners. No runtime fetches remain. Vendored archives are signed at package time. The signing key used for the font bundle follows below.

deploy key for yajop-fahop: bky3_h1v

# Heads up, plugin folks: these values come from the Glimmerkit
# color-contrast audit we ran last quarter. The Tintsworth team
# flagged a bunch of widgets that looked fine on dev monitors but
# failed WCAG checks on cheaper panels. Don't hardcode your own
# ratios — pull from here so everything stays consistent across
# the marketplace. The current tuning constants are as follows.

tuning constants:
WEIGHTS = {
    "kasion": 449,
    "julax": 314,
    "novdor": 823,
    "ralmir": 390,
    "novael": 220,
}